NEIU PROJECT STEPTo meet district and State needs for increasing teacher qualifications, Project STEP will offer cohort and non-cohort Tuition Benefit Programs for up to 180 teachers in Summer 2017. Project STEP cohort program will host four cohorts for Bilingual or English as a Second Language (BIL/ESL) SPED Approval (available to SPED teachers and school support personnel), with face-to-face, online and hybrid instruction. Cohorts will be offered in a Cicero-Berwyn based location, and at NEIU. The Project STEP non-cohort Tuition Benefit Program will support out-of-cohort partici-pants to complete requirements for bilingual/ESL endorse-ment or dual credit qualifications for high school teachers. Benefits for all participants include:

For Project STEP cohort program

• Tuition-waived courses through NEIU

• Up to $100 reimbursement per course for required textbooks

• Reimbursement for endorsement application and language testing fees (before September 30, 2017)

For Project STEP Non-cohort Tuition Benefit Program

• Receive tuition waivers for taking applicable courses at NEIU through August 10, 2017.

• Receive tuition reimbursement up to $1,250 per course for taking applicable courses at other universitiesthrough August 30, 2017.

• Receive up to $100 reimbursement per course for textbooks

• Reimbursement for endorsement application and language testing fees (before September 30, 2017).

Project STEP is a collaborative effort between Northeastern Illinois University (NEIU) and the NEIU Center for College Access and Success, through NCLB-Illinois Board of Higher Education (IBHE) funding. The project will be housed in and managed by the NEIU Center for College Access and Success, who will administer and manage the project in accordance with official NEIU policies ensuring that no person will encounter discrimination in education on the basis of color, handicap, national origin, religion, gender, disability, or veteran's status. All activities will be completed by September 30, 2017.

BECOME A PROJECT STEP PARTICIPANT

To become a Project STEP participant, candidates will complete an application demonstrating their educational plan and commitment to meeting endorsement or qualifi-cation requirements. Once accepted, candidates will be required to provide a one-time $30 NEIU application fee and $50 one-time STEP commitment fee to secure their NEIU application and project participation, and subse-quently receive tuition and fee benefits.
